Programozás nrf24le1 a málna pi
Számozása következtetések a BCM GPIO.Ne felejtsük el azt is nullázódik nRF24LE1 plyus.GND húzza, és csatlakozzon VDD sootsvestvuyuschie következtetéseket Raspberry PI 3.3V kínálat. Felhívom a figyelmet arra, hogy a kiviteltől függően, a chip ház nRF24LE1 kapcsolat jön létre a különböző vyvodam.Smotrite sootsvetstviya oldalon lévő táblázatot nRF24LE1.
A programozó telepítése Raspberry PI-re
A Raspberry PI programozó sikeres működéséhez a telepített bcm2835 könyvtárra van szükség, itt a telepítés leírása látható.
A program archívumát Raspberry PI-re kell kicsomagolni, például a home könyvtárba / home / pi / nrf /.
Ezután össze kell állítania a programot a standard make paranccsal.
A program sikeres összeszerelése után elkezdheti programozni az nRF24LE1 programot.
Jelenleg 3 segédprogram működik:
./ nrf24le1 teszt - kinyomtatja az nRF24LE1 tesztinformációkat.

./ nrf24le1 write - felülírja a main.bin fájlt, amely ugyanabban a mappában található az nRF24LE1-ben

Mi lehetséges, hogy az nRF24LE1 nincs megfelelően csatlakoztatva.
./ Nrf24le1 olvasni -sozdast firmware billenő származó nRF24LE1 utónév fő-dump.bin .Ha a fájl csak nullát vagy azonos byte, lehetséges nRF24LE1 igazi próba nincs csatlakoztatva.
By the way, a programozó igényel egy bináris fájlt letölteni, de a fordító SDCC egy fájl hexadecimális (.ihx). Átalakítani firmware igazi teszt formátumban van szüksége, használja HEX2BIN közüzemi végre ./hex2bin -p 00 main.ihx .A parancs lehet rendelni, hogy a fájl az alábbi parancsok összeállítására automatikus létrehozásához bin fájlt.